Official summary
This Preliminary information communicates a process to correct the concern of Unable to contact OnStar after the 3G EOL on 2015-2022 model year vehicles in the United States.

What a TSB means. Technical service bulletins are repair guidance manufacturers send to dealers — they are not recalls, and repairs are not automatically free (warranty extensions are an exception worth checking). The full document is available via NHTSA’s vehicle lookup.
